Synopsis
SIMON GODDARD is a regular contributor to Q Magazine and has also written for the Guardian, Independent on Sunday , Sunday Herald and Uncut . Dubbed 'the Smiths authority' by NME , his 2002 book The Smiths -- Songs That Saved Your Life was described as a mighty achievement' by both Time Out and Mojo and is recognised as one of the key works on the group by fans and critics. It is also the only Smiths book to earn the approval of group founder and guitarist Johnny Marr.
